It is highly likely that The DLA Unit have sent a G.P. Factual Report, (GPFR) to your G.P. to provide information to them to help them come to a decision.

It should be beneficial for you to discuss this with your G.P., and should be viewed positively, as many G.P.'s simply fill these in without consulting their patients.

When discussing this with your G.P., you should remember that is the care needs and mobility limitations that you suffer as a result of your medical conditions that are important, more so than the conditions themselves.
